Robeco hires Álvaro de la Peña

Robeco, the Dutch asset manager known for its sustainable investing heritage, has brought Álvaro de la Peña on board as Client Relationship Manager for the Iberian region. The appointment is part of a broader push to deepen the firm’s footprint in Spain’s private banking sector, where competition for high-net-worth clients is heating up. De la Peña will be based in Madrid and will work closely with the existing Iberia commercial team to drive business development and strengthen ties with key partners.

A Career Built on Relationships

Before joining Robeco, Álvaro de la Peña accumulated solid experience across several Spanish financial institutions. He previously worked at Urbanitae Wealth, where he managed relationships with ultra-high-net-worth individuals and institutional clients. His career also includes stints at Azora and Abante Asesores, where he focused on business development and client servicing for family offices and financial advisory firms. Earlier roles at Athletika and Crédit Agricole’s investment banking division gave him a broad view of the financial industry.

De la Peña holds a degree in Business Administration from the Autonomous University of Madrid and is a certified European Financial Advisor (EFA).
